🦸‍♂️ The Fantastic Four: First Steps – A Retro-Futuristic Marvel Adventure





 Marvel Studios is set to introduce a fresh take on its iconic superhero team with The Fantastic Four: First Steps, scheduled for release on July 25, 2025. Directed by Matt Shakman (WandaVision), this film promises to deliver a unique blend of action, heart, and cosmic adventure.

🌟 A Stellar Cast

The film boasts an impressive ensemble cast:

  • Pedro Pascal as Reed Richards/Mister Fantastic

  • Vanessa Kirby as Sue Storm/Invisible Woman

  • Joseph Quinn as Johnny Storm/Human Torch

  • Ebon Moss-Bachrach as Ben Grimm/The Thing

  • Julia Garner as Shalla-Bal/Silver Surfer

  • Ralph Ineson as Galactus

Additionally, Paul Walter Hauser, John Malkovich, and Natasha Lyonne have been cast in undisclosed roles, adding to the film's intrigue .

πŸ•°️ A 1960s-Inspired World

Set in a retro-futuristic 1960s-inspired universe, The Fantastic Four: First Steps offers a visually distinct experience. The film's aesthetic draws inspiration from the optimism and innovation of the 1960s, providing a fresh backdrop for the team's origin story .

🌌 Facing Galactus

The Fantastic Four must unite to protect their world from the cosmic threat of Galactus, a planet-devouring entity. With the Silver Surfer as his herald, the team faces their most daunting challenge yet, testing their strength and unity .

🎢 Musical Score by Michael Giacchino

Renowned composer Michael Giacchino, known for his work on various MCU projects, has crafted the film's score. His music for the Fantastic Four and Galactus has been previewed during events like SDCC, generating excitement among fans .

πŸ“… Release Date

The Fantastic Four: First Steps is set to open in theaters on July 25, 2025, marking the beginning of Phase Six of the MCU. Fans can look forward to an action-packed and emotionally resonant addition to the Marvel Cinematic Universe .
